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M4

The NM_002775.5(HTRA1):​c.43_48dupCTGCTG​(p.Leu15_Leu16dup) variant causes a conservative inframe insertion change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000536 in 1,307,110 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
HTRA1 (HGNC:9476): (HtrA serine peptidase 1) This gene encodes a member of the trypsin family of serine proteases. This protein is a secreted enzyme that is proposed to regulate the availability of insulin-like growth factors (IGFs) by cleaving IGF-binding proteins. It has also been suggested to be a regulator of cell growth. Variations in the promoter region of this gene are the cause of susceptibility to age-related macular degeneration type 7.
